DESCRIPTION
Although brainstorming can be an ideal way to generate ideas, it comes with challenges that include the risk of inferior ideas, participant inhibitions and reduced morale. This Blue Paper examines brainstorming alternatives such as blitzing, brainswarming, e-brainstorming and timeboxing.

Brainstorming occurs in a pre-set time period or timebox. When the time limit is reached, participants pause to evaluate ideas, summarize key pointsand refocus.
Individuals brainstorm 9 new ideas in 2 minutes and then share with the group.
Swarm, don’t storm. Small swarms work together on a problem until it is solved. Then, together, they move on to tackle the next problem.
Individuals generate ideas via computer and a facilitator compiles them and presents them to the group for appraisal.
